Xadrez
The Xadrez Club Chair stands out through a bold graphic language, where patterns and materials interact with confidence. The contrast between textured surfaces and compact volumes shapes an expressive piece that feels both playful and rigorous, grounded in contemporary craftsmanship.
Product detail
Materials: Coconut fiber, enamel paint & natural cow hide.
Dimensions:
W x D x H: 60 x 65 x 60 cm
W x D x H: 23.6 x 25.6 x 23.6 in

Palma is a creative studio based in São Paulo, where architecture, design, and visual art intersect seamlessly. Founded by artist Cleo Döbberthin and architect Lorenzo Lo Schiavo, the studio develops a cross-disciplinary language spanning space, furniture, and scenography. Each project explores materiality, composition, and scale through an experimental approach, resulting in pieces that feel both expressive and grounded in contemporary Brazilian culture.
